Official title
A Prospective, Single-Arm, Single-Center, Phase II Clinical Study of CM336 Combined With SOC Therapy in Patients With Dynamically High-Risk Multiple Myeloma
Overview
This is a single-arm, open-label study to evaluate the efficacy and safety of CM336 combined with SOC therapy in patients with dynamically high-risk multiple myeloma.
Interventions
- Drug anti-BCMA/CD3 bispecific antibody
Anti-BCMA/CD3 bispecific antibody (CM336) will be administered via a subcutaneous injection (SC).
Primary outcome measures
- Minimal residual disease (MRD) negativity rate [Time frame: 12 months]
Secondary outcome measures (6)
- Adverse events and serious adverse events [Time frame: Up to 2 year]
- Sustained MRD negativity rate [Time frame: Up to 2 year]
- Overall response rate (ORR) [Time frame: Up to 2 year]
- Complete response rate (CR) [Time frame: Up to 2 year]
- Duration of response (DoR) [Time frame: Up to 2 year]
- Progression-free survival (PFS) [Time frame: From the first dose of study treatment until the date of first documented disease progression or death from any cause, whichever occurs first, assessed up to approximately 24 months.]
Eligibility criteria
Inclusion criteria
- Able to understand and voluntarily sign the informed consent form (ICF).
- Aged ≥18 and ≤75 years.
- Has measurable disease, meeting at least one of the following criteria: serum M-protein ≥5 g/L as measured by serum protein electrophoresis (SPEP); or, for IgA or IgD myeloma, quantitative IgA or IgD levels may be used instead; or urine M-protein ≥200 mg/24 hours; if neither serum nor urine M-protein meets the above criteria, involved serum free light chain (FLC) ≥100 mg/L in the presence of an abnormal serum FLC ratio (normal FLC ratio: 0.26 to 1.65).
- Has received only one prior line of standard anti-myeloma therapy: standard induction therapy comprising at least two of the following: a proteasome inhibitor, an immunomodulatory agent, and an anti-CD38 monoclonal antibody; followed by autologous hematopoietic stem cell transplantation or consolidation therapy, and standard maintenance therapy.
- Meets the definition of functional high-risk multiple myeloma according to the EMN consensus: disease progression or relapse within 18 months after initiation of any first-line therapy.
- Liver function tests meet the following criteria: total bilirubin <1.5 × upper limit of normal (ULN) (except that patients with Gilbert's syndrome must have total bilirubin <3 × ULN), and aspartate aminotransferase (AST) and alanine aminotransferase (ALT) ≤2.5 × ULN.
- Renal function tests meet the following criterion: creatinine clearance ≥30 mL/min, calculated using the Cockcroft-Gault formula.
- Complete blood count within 7 days before screening meets the following criteria: white blood cell (WBC) count ≥1.5 × 10⁹/L, absolute neutrophil count ≥1.0 × 10⁹/L, hemoglobin ≥70 g/L, and platelet count ≥75 × 10⁹/L if bone marrow plasma cells are <50%, or platelet count ≥50 × 10⁹/L if bone marrow plasma cells are ≥50%; or, in the investigator's judgment based on the actual clinical situation, the subject is considered suitable for enrollment.
- For patients receiving hematopoietic growth factor support, including erythropoietin, granulocyte colony-stimulating factor (G-CSF), granulocyte-macrophage colony-stimulating factor (GM-CSF), and platelet agonists, etc. (e.g., eltrombopag, TPO, interleukin-11), there must be an interval of 2 weeks between growth factor support and screening assessment.
- For patients receiving blood product transfusions: there must be an interval of at least 2 weeks between the screening hemoglobin assessment and the last red blood cell (RBC) transfusion, and an interval of at least 1 week between the screening platelet assessment and the last platelet transfusion.
- The subject is able to receive the prophylactic anticoagulation recommended in the study.
- Female subjects of childbearing potential must meet both of the following conditions: agree to use effective contraception from the date of signing the informed consent form, during treatment with the study drug, and for 3 months after the last dose of the study drug; and have a negative serum pregnancy test result at screening.
Exclusion criteria
- Primary plasma cell leukemia or secondary plasma cell leukemia.
- Concurrent amyloidosis.
- Concurrent central nervous system (CNS) involvement.
- Prior treatment with BCMA-targeted therapy or CAR-T cell therapy.
- Known intolerance, allergy, or contraindication to glucocorticoids or BCMA/CD3 bispecific antibody products.
- Clinically significant cardiac disease, including: myocardial infarction before randomization; or unstable or uncontrolled disease related to or affecting cardiac function, such as unstable angina, congestive heart failure, or New York Heart Association class III-IV cardiac function. Uncontrolled arrhythmia or clinically significant ECG abnormalities. Baseline corrected QT interval (QTc) >470 msec on 12-lead ECG at screening.
- Known active human immunodeficiency virus (HIV) infection or HIV seropositivity.
- Active hepatitis B or C infection. Hepatitis serology testing is required at screening. If hepatitis B surface antigen or hepatitis B core antibody is positive, a negative DNA polymerase chain reaction (PCR) result must be confirmed before enrollment; for patients receiving anti-hepatitis B antiviral therapy, a negative DNA PCR result must be confirmed before enrollment. If hepatitis C antibody is positive, RNA PCR testing must be performed, and a negative result must be confirmed before enrollment.
- Pregnant or breastfeeding women.
- Life expectancy <6 months.
- Any active gastrointestinal dysfunction that affects the patient's ability to swallow tablets, or any active gastrointestinal dysfunction that may affect absorption of the study treatment.
- Major surgery within 2 weeks before the start of randomization, such as surgery requiring general anesthesia; incomplete recovery from surgery; or planned surgery during the study period. Kyphoplasty or vertebroplasty is not considered major surgery.
Note: Subjects scheduled to undergo surgical procedures under local anesthesia may participate in the study.
- Receipt of a live attenuated vaccine within 4 weeks before the first dose of study drug.
